Food And Environment Reporting Network
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 74,858 | 21,255 | 53,603 | 30.3 | — |
| 2012 | 378,518 | 250,323 | 128,195 | 8.7 | 17% |
| 2013 | 637,096 | 388,721 | 248,375 | 13.3 | 26% |
| 2014 | 670,506 | 655,236 | 15,270 | 8.2 | 22% |
| 2015 | 805,672 | 740,496 | 65,176 | 8.3 | 33% |
| 2016 | 844,751 | 912,662 | −67,911 | 5.8 | 46% |
| 2017 | 730,746 | 1,058,175 | −327,429 | 1.3 | 45% |
| 2018 | 1,101,051 | 1,207,992 | −106,941 | 0.1 | 40% |
| 2019 | 619,502 | 517,241 | 102,261 | 2.6 | 48% |
| 2020 | 1,307,106 | 891,523 | 415,583 | 7.1 | 58% |
| 2021 | 1,051,083 | 1,046,455 | 4,628 | 6.1 | 51% |
| 2022 | 1,382,993 | 1,304,344 | 78,649 | 5.6 | 50% |
| 2023 | 1,326,124 | 1,318,716 | 7,408 | 5.6 | 54%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$7,408 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 5.6 months of spending, down from 30.3 in 2011. Staff pay was 54% of spending. $540,844 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ash.
